WebMay 10, 2024 · There are 45 calories in 2 oz (56 g) of Great Value Canned Chunk Chicken Breast. Calorie breakdown: 20% fat, 0% carbs, 80% protein. Get our recipe for Chicken Salad Sandwich with Raisins and Curry Powder. 4. WebIn a medium bowl, combine mayo, onions, relish and 2 dashes or so of paprika. Add chicken and fold into mayo mixture until well combined. Taste and then add salt and pepper as needed. Chill well and serve over lettuce or on your favorite bread.
